不同含量腐植酸复合肥对葡萄产量和品质的影响 被引量:7

The Effects of Compound Fertilizers Containing Different Humic Acid(HA) Contents on Yield and Quality of Grape

摘要 腐植酸能够显著提高养分利用率,提高作物产量、改善农产品品质。本试验以葡萄为供试作物,采用随机区组设计,研究不同含量腐植酸复合肥对葡萄产量和品质的影响。研究结果表明:施用含15%腐植酸复合肥的葡萄比常规施入化肥增产62%,能明显改善葡萄果实品质。含20%腐植酸的复合肥处理的葡萄叶片叶绿素含量最高的,达50.01 mg kg^-1;当腐植酸含量为15%时,葡萄果实的可溶性糖含量为15.47%,与对照相比,增加3.7%;腐植酸含量为10%~15%时,葡萄果实中Vc含量最高,达1.35 mg kg^-1,是对照的1.5倍;以15%含量腐植酸的复合肥处理的葡萄果实的总酸度含量最低,其葡萄果实的总酸度含量为0.8%,总酸度降低22.5%。综上,以腐植酸含量10~15%的复合肥对葡萄产量和品质效果为最佳。 Humic acid can increase nutrient use efficiency, increase crop yields and improve crop quality. In this study, the grape was used as the experimental material, and the random block design was used to study the effects of organic fertilizer containing different humic acidon grape yield and quality. The results showed that the application of fertilizer containing 15% humic acid increased the yield of grapes by 62% compared with conventional application of chemical fertilizer. The effect of grape quality was improved significantly. Grape leaves treated with compound fertilizer containing 20% humic acid had the highest chlorophyll content, the content is 50.01 mg kg^-1;compound fertilizer containing 20% humic acid In summary, organic fertilizer with humic acid content of 10 ~ 15% is the best for grape yield and quality.
